Lake Luzerne, NY vs Madison, NY
Madison is moderately more affordable than Lake Luzerne, with a 10.3% lower cost of living index. Lake Luzerne scores 89 compared to 81 for Madison, where the US average is 100. This difference means residents of Lake Luzerne can expect to pay noticeably more for everyday expenses, housing, and services.
When it comes to buying, median home values in Lake Luzerne are $198,300 compared to $105,800 in Madison, a 87% gap.
Median household income in Lake Luzerne is $53,594 compared to $43,750 in Madison (+22.5%). While Lake Luzerne is more expensive, its higher salaries more than compensate — residents there may actually end up with more disposable income.
Climate-wise, both cities share similar average temperatures (45.7°F vs 46.7°F). Madison receives more rainfall at 44" per year compared to 38.2" in Lake Luzerne.
